Tonfanau Beach is a long shingle-and-sand shore just north of Tywyn, backed by the railway and low dunes, with easy walk-on access from the lane/parking by the beach. It fishes as an open-coast surf mark with a gentle slope and patches of mixed ground; most anglers target flatfish and school...

Tywyn Beach is a long, open sandy bay on Cardigan Bay with easy promenade and slipway access along the seafront. Most anglers fish clean sand for flats, rays and dogfish, with occasional bass and mackerel when shoals come in; it’s generally a “chuck-and-wait” beach mark that fishes best with a...

Fairbourne Beach is a long, open, gently sloping shingle-and-sand beach on the south side of the Mawddach estuary, with easy access from the village and car parks onto the foreshore. It fishes as a classic North Wales surf mark: flatties close in on the ebb, dogfish and rays from mid-distance,...

Friog (Morfa Mawddach) is a wide sandy beach at the north side of the Mawddach Estuary mouth by Fairbourne, giving easy access from nearby parking and paths across the dunes. Barmouth Beach is a long, gently sloping sandy surf beach on the north side of the Mawddach estuary, easy to access from the promenade and nearby parking. It fishes as a classic mixed flatfish and bass venue, with best sport around the flooding tide and at dusk/night when fish move...

Barmouth Estuary is a broad tidal reach where the Mawddach meets Cardigan Bay, giving classic estuary fishing from accessible shorelines, slipways and harbour edges around Barmouth/Fairbourne.
